根因分析算法如何应对大规模数据集?
在当今这个数据爆炸的时代,如何从海量数据中找到问题的根本原因,成为了许多企业和研究机构关注的焦点。根因分析算法作为一种高效的数据分析方法,在应对大规模数据集方面展现出强大的能力。本文将深入探讨根因分析算法如何应对大规模数据集,以及其在实际应用中的优势。
一、根因分析算法概述
根因分析算法,又称为因果分析算法,旨在通过挖掘数据之间的因果关系,找到影响结果的最根本原因。它主要分为两大类:基于统计的方法和基于机器学习的方法。
基于统计的方法:通过对大量数据进行统计分析,找出变量之间的相关性,从而推断出因果关系。这种方法在处理大规模数据集时,具有较高的计算效率。
基于机器学习的方法:利用机器学习算法,如决策树、随机森林等,对数据进行训练,从而建立预测模型。这种方法在处理非线性关系和复杂模型方面具有优势。
二、根因分析算法应对大规模数据集的优势
高效处理:根因分析算法采用分布式计算技术,可以将大规模数据集分解为多个子集,并行处理,从而提高计算效率。
可视化分析:根因分析算法可以将分析结果以图表、图形等形式呈现,方便用户直观地了解数据之间的关系。
可解释性强:与传统机器学习算法相比,根因分析算法更注重因果关系的挖掘,因此其分析结果具有更强的可解释性。
适应性:根因分析算法可以根据不同领域的需求,调整模型参数,使其适应不同的数据类型和规模。
三、案例分析
以下以一个实际案例说明根因分析算法在应对大规模数据集方面的应用。
案例:某电商平台在促销活动中,发现销售额波动较大。为了找出影响销售额的根本原因,该平台采用根因分析算法对销售数据进行分析。
数据预处理:对销售数据进行清洗、去重等预处理操作,确保数据质量。
特征工程:根据业务需求,提取与销售额相关的特征,如用户年龄、地区、商品类别等。
模型训练:利用根因分析算法,对提取的特征进行训练,建立预测模型。
结果分析:分析预测模型,找出影响销售额的关键因素,如用户年龄、地区等。
优化策略:根据分析结果,调整促销策略,提高销售额。
通过根因分析算法,该电商平台成功找到了影响销售额的根本原因,并优化了促销策略,取得了显著的业绩提升。
四、总结
根因分析算法作为一种高效的数据分析方法,在应对大规模数据集方面具有显著优势。随着技术的不断发展,根因分析算法将在更多领域得到应用,为企业提供更精准的数据洞察。
猜你喜欢:可观测性平台